What is a spandrel panel?
A spandrel panel is an infill panel typically installed between floor slabs within a curtain wall or facade system. Its purpose is to conceal structural elements while maintaining the external appearance of the building.
Modern insulated spandrel panels also contribute to the overall thermal performance of the building envelope and must integrate seamlessly with surrounding facade systems. As a result, they play a much greater role in the overall performance of a building than many people realise.
How spandrel panels have evolved
Thirty-five years ago, the facade industry looked very different.
Spandrel panels were already widely used, but there was less emphasis on testing, certification and documented performance. Specification decisions often relied on previous experience or established practice rather than independently verified data.
Since then, building regulations, industry standards and client expectations have evolved significantly. Greater focus on building safety, sustainability and long-term performance has transformed the way facade systems are designed and specified.
Today, every component within the building envelope is expected to contribute to the overall performance of the facade, making spandrel panels a critical element rather than simply a finishing detail.
Why specification matters more than ever
Modern specifiers are not just selecting products; they are managing risk.
When specifying spandrel panels, considerations now include:
- Fire classification and compliance
- Thermal performance
- Integration with the wider facade system
- Independent testing and certification
- Long-term durability
- Technical support and documentation
There is little room for assumption. Architects and contractors require systems that are backed by robust evidence and supported throughout the specification process.
